FAIR DISMISSAL LANGUAGE Sample Clauses

FAIR DISMISSAL LANGUAGE. The Board and Association agree to the mutual benefit of a Fair Dismissal procedure for experienced teachers. This provision balances the relative security earned through an extended and successful probationary period with employer expectations of continued quality professional performance. If a teacher is terminated, he/she shall be afforded the rights to this procedure to appeal that decision. For the first three years of professional employment with the district, teachers are considered probationary and may be non-renewed prior to the statutory deadline for any reason except as protected by Constitutional or other nondiscrimination protections. Starting in year four of teaching with the district, teachers shall have earned non-probationary status. At its discretion, the Board may formally grant non-probationary status to any teacher earlier. Non-probationary teachers may be non-renewed for just cause. Including: ineffective performance, provided the procedural process is closely observed. While timelines are expected to be followed, extenuating circumstances may be considered for minor procedural errors. If the proposed non-renewal is to be based on ineffective performance, the district evaluation procedure shall be followed. The non-probationary teacher will be informed his/her performance is substandard and the full evaluation process will be utilized, including a measurable plan of improvement. The plan of improvement shall be collaboratively developed but the final decision on the plan rests with the principals. If the non-renewal is based on other reasons, including disciplinary factors or reduction in force, those separate procedures as outlined in the Agreement shall be followed prior to the termination or non-renewal. If the non-probationary teacher is non-renewed, he/she shall be notified by certified and regular mail prior to the statutory continuing contract date. The notification shall include the reason for the non-renewal. The non-renewed teacher will have 14 calendar days from the receipt of the letter to file a written request with the Board Clerk for a hearing. Within 7 calendar days, the parties shall meet and select a mutually agreeable party to be the hearing officer. If that is not possible, the hearing officer shall be an arbitrator selected by alternately striking names from the KSDE list or the AAA list.
